Descrizione generale
β-Galactosidase is a tetramer consisting of four equal subunits of 135,000 Da each. It is a sulfhydryl containing enzyme, with 19 cysteine residues per subunit.
Applicazioni
β-Galactosidase is conjugated to an antibody that specifically recognizes a target molecule (enzyme immunoassay or EIA). β-Galactosidase is also used as a reporter enzyme to monitor the level of gene expression of a promoter.
Azioni biochim/fisiol
β-galactosidase cleaves lactose into its monosaccharide components, glucose and galactose. It also catalyses the transglycosylation of glucose into allolactose, the inducer of β-galactosidase, in a feedback loop.

Definizione di unità
One unit will hydrolyze 1.0 μmole of o-nitrophenyl β-D-galactoside to o-nitrophenol and D-galactose per min at pH 7.3 at 37 °C.
Stato fisico
Partially purified; contains Tris buffer salts, magnesium chloride, DL-dithiothreitol and 2-mercaptoethanol
